Did I do this correctly?
I have a given applied voltage of 208.
R1= 50Ω, R2= 75Ω, R3= 400Ω (R2 & R3 in parallel), R4= 100Ω, R5= 400Ω (R4 & R5 in parallel), and lastly R6= 175Ω.
I have figured R2&R3= 63.157 and R4&R5= 80Ω
I added all together with a total of 368.157Ω
Rt= 368.157Ω
It= .565
Er1= 28.25 volts
Er2&3= 35.683 volts
Er4&5= 45.2 volts
Er6= 98.875 volts
( To check I rounded the answers to 28v + 36V + 45V + 99v)
I then got 208 volts which is my applied voltage.
